Lonely Planet's local travel experts reveal all you need to know to plan a multi-week adventure to Western USA. Hike through big nature, taste your way around wine regions, hit up the wild and wacky west, with our classic travel guide that's packed with comprehensive itineraries, maps and essential tips so you can create the trip of a lifetime.

Lonely Planet's local travel experts reveal all you need to know to plan the trip of a lifetime in this latest edition of our guide to Western USA.

Discover Western USA's most popular experiences and best kept secrets from taking in Washington's powerful volcanoes by hiking Mt Rainier, to sampling some of America's best wines in Napa Valley, and seeing if lady luck is on your side in Las Vegas.
